    Top Four Places to Visit in and around Bali

    Ubud

    Ubud is pretty away from the beaches. It is considered the cultural center of Bali, where you will discover the art and spirit of Bali and learn about Balinese religion through paintings, dance, and other art forms. You could drink a beer while watching a local band perform, but most people come here for the cultural appreciation.

    Nusa Lembongan

    This tiny island off the coast of Bali is where many people miss their journey plans, but it is a must-see. It is the perfect place to stay for a couple of nights. The roads are not good, but the island itself is so beautiful and quiet.

    Sanur

    Sanur is an especially relaxing beach town. It's close to the airport and Kuta. It's also the starting place to explore Nusa Lembongan.

    Kuta

    The beach of Kuta is great for surfing. It is crowded and you won't get far without some­one trying to get you to rent a surfboard or buy something. The main town is a mixture of market stands and shopping malls containing the biggest brands, from Zara to Ralph Lauren.

    The familiarity of the western style shops and restaurants won't give anyone too much of a culture shock.

    Paper is an important part of modern life. People use it in school, at work, to make art­work and books, to wrap presents and much more. Trees are the most common material for paper these days.

    So how do people make paper out of trees today? People first cut trees, load them onto trucks and bring them to a factory. Machines cut open the outer coverings of the trees, and cut the trees into pieces. Those pieces are boiled into a soup. After that, it is hit flat, dried and cut up into sheets of paper.

    The entire process, from planting a small tree to buying your school notebook, takes a very long time. Just growing the trees takes 10 to 20 years.

    Making tons of paper from trees can harm the planet. Humans cut down 80, 000 to 160,000 trees around the world every day, and use many of them to make paper. Some of those trees come from tree farms. But people also cut down forests for paper, which means that animals and birds lose their homes.

    Cutting forests down also contributes to climate change, and paper factories pollute the air. After you throw paper, it often takes the paper six to nine years to break down. That's why recycling is important. It saves a lot of trees, slows climate change and helps protect en­dangered animals, birds and all creatures that rely on forests for their homes and food.

    So if paper isn't good for the environment, why don't people write on something else?

    The answer: They do. With computers, tablets and cellphones, people use much less paper than in the past. Maybe a day will come when we won't use paper at allor will save it for very special books and artworks.

    According to the study posted on ScienceDirect, gardening just two to three times a week increase the benefits of better well-being as much as possible and lower stress levels.

    The research explored why residents engaged with gardening and the extent to which they recognized any health benefits from the activity.

    A questionnaire was handed out electronically within the UK, with 5,766 gardeners and 249 non-gardeners responding. Data was collected on factors including garden typology (类型学)frequency of gardening and individual awareness of health and well-being.

    "This is the first time the dose response (剂量效应)to gardening has been tested and the evidence from the survey strongly suggests that the more frequently you garden, the greater the health benefits," said Royal Horticultural Society (RHS) lead author Dr Lauriane Chalmin-Pui. In fact, gardening every day has the same positive impact on well-being than un­dertaking regular and powerful exercise like cycling or running.

    When gardening, our brains are pleasantly entertained by nature around us. Gardening takes our attention away from ourselves and our stresses, therefore, it helps restore our minds and reduce unfavorable feelings.

    Improving health, however, was not the main motive power to garden, but rather the direct pleasure gardening brought to the participants.

    "Gardening is like effortless exercise because it doesn't feel as exhausting and hard as going to the gym, for example, but we can expend similar amounts of energy," Chalmin-Pui added.

    Most people say they garden for pleasure and enjoyment, so people who like gardening may be easy to be addicted to it. However, this sometimes may become a piece of good news, from the aspect of mental health. "We hope all the millions of new gardeners will be getting their daily gardening and feeling all the better for it. " Chalmin-Pui said in the interview.
